CARROTS WITH GRAPE AND PORT GLAZE

My girlfriend brought this dish over as part of our progressive dinner. It was gorgeous & very tasty! If you cannot find carrots with leafy tops, small slender carrots without the tops will work nicely as well. From: Better Homes & Gardens, November 2004.

Steps:

  • Peel or scrub and trim carrot tops, leaving about 1 1/2 inch of carrot top.
  • Halve any thick carrots lengthwise.
  • Place in a 4 quart Dutch oven along with the rosemary sprigs. Add water to cover. Season with salt.
  • Bring to boiling; reduce heat. Simmer, covered for 8-10 minutes or until crisp-tender. Do not over cook.
  • Drain carefully in a colander; remove and discard rosemary sprigs (some leaves will remain).
  • Add butter to the Dutch oven; heat just until butter melts.
  • Return carrots to dutch oven and toss to coat.
  • Arrange carrots on serving platter, top with some jelly.
  • NOTE: To substitute for Wild Grape & Port Jelly: whisk together 1/4 C grape jelly and 1 T port, grape juice or apple juice.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 72.1, Fat 3.1, SaturatedFat 1.9, Cholesterol 7.6, Sodium 98.9, Carbohydrate 10.9, Fiber 3.2, Sugar 5.2, Protein 1.1

2 lbs carrots, small, whole with tops
4 sprigs fresh rosemary, 4 6-inch sprigs
salt, to taste
2 tablespoons butter
1/3 cup wild grape and port jelly, substitute noted

GRAPE GLAZED CARROTS

From the Concord Grape Association. *I have made this recipe since posting it - It's very good, sweet with a nice lemon punch - my kids and dh liked them. Depending on what size you cut your carrots I think the 10 minutes cooking time with the glaze is plenty (go ahead & skip the cooking in salted water or just lightly blanch them; mine came out too mushy when I boiled them AND cooked w/the glaze for 10m); also there is enough glaze for 4-5 cups of carrots (I used regular carrots).

Steps:

  • Pare carrots and cut into 2-inch pieces by slicing diagonally.
  • Cook until tender in lightly salted water then drain.
  • Combine butter, Concord grape jam, lemon juice, lemon peel and ginger in a saucepan then add carrots.
  • Cook for 10 minutes over moderate heat, turning often to thoroughly glaze carrots.
  • Garnish with pecans.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 188, Fat 8, SaturatedFat 2.3, Cholesterol 7.6, Sodium 33.4, Carbohydrate 29.3, Fiber 1.2, Sugar 19.9, Protein 0.9

2 bunches young carrots
1 tablespoon butter
1/2 cup concord grape jam
2 tablespoons lemon juice
1/2 teaspoon grated lemon peel
1/4 teaspoon ground ginger
2 tablespoons toasted chopped pecans
